See all roles

Senior Data Engineer (ClickStream)

Work from home Full-time role Hiring

Get on board with B3!

As Polish outsourcing company with Scandinavian roots, we particularly appraise values such as Scandinavian energy, logic, experience and freedom, this all comes in a Scandinavian work culture.

Our "CARE" philosophy is not just a word - it is a way of thinking. We take care of your needs, adapt solutions and take appropriate care of everything.

B3 Consulting Poland is not just a workplace, it is a community of enthusiastic people

If you want to be part of our crew, we invite you on a journey to a galaxy far, far away

We are currently looking for

Senior Data Engineer

to create a leading digital innovation center in Poland with us.

Areas of the project:

  • Develop and maintain robust, scalable streaming data pipelines (primarily clickstream), enabling real-time and batch data processing.
  • Design and implement data solutions for Self-Service Analytics, supporting business users with accessible, reliable data.
  • Monitor, optimize, and ensure data quality and integrity across pipelines and analytics solutions.

What do you need to have to join us:

Must haves:

  • Strong proficiency in Python (~60% of work) and Scala (key for streaming pipelines); Java/Kotlin are less relevant but JVM familiarity is a plus.
  • Experience in building and maintaining streaming pipelines (e.g., Apache Beam, Dataflow, or similar).
  • Deep knowledge of Google Cloud Platform – especially BigQuery, Composer, and Dataflow.
  • Expertise in SQL and DBT (essential for Self-Service Analytics).
  • Solid understanding of data modeling and cloud data warehouse architecture.
  • Experience with Spark or PySpark (not necessarily in a Hadoop environment).
  • Familiarity with Linux/Unix and Docker.
  • Proficient in Git or similar version control systems.
  • Adherence to software development best practices (Clean Code, CI/CD, code reviews).
  • Interest in emerging technologies (Generative AI, LLMs, Copilot).
  • Teamwork, autonomy, and proactive attitude.
  • English at B2 level, Polish at C1 or better.
  • You have to be eligible to work in Poland (citizenship, residency, work permit or local self-proprietorhsip)

Nice to haves:

  • Apache Beam and Scio (must have for streaming pipelines, but can be learned if not already known).
  • Terraform or other IaC tools.
  • Spring Framework
  • Pandas, NumPy
  • Familiarity with medalion architecture (would be a strong plus)

On board with B3 you will receive:

  • Health and sports benefits tailored to your needs
  • Free running and swimming training, internal triathlon team, joint competitions (Warsaw)
  • Tailor-made development activities to deepen expert knowledge
  • Cyclical initiatives allowing development in IT fields other than the current one

Apply today

Originally posted on Himalayas

Apply To this Job

You might like

Senior Estimator (remote allowed)

Work from home Full-time role

Associate Account Manager

Work from home Full-time role

Regional Safety, Health & Environmental Manager

Work from home Full-time role

Revenue Manager

Work from home Full-time role

Full Stack Product Engineer

Work from home Full-time role

Registered Nurse - Patient Educator (PRN) Immediate Openings - Hartford, CT

Work from home Full-time role

Bulgarian Remote Interpreter

Work from home Full-time role

Digital [Web] Designer

Work from home Full-time role

Senior Partnership Manager

Work from home Full-time role

Customer Success Executive

Work from home Full-time role

Claims Examiner II, Professional Lines

Work from home Full-time role

Tele Chat / Phone Chat Support

Work from home Full-time role

Sr. Mobile Diesel Mechanic

Work from home Full-time role

Remote RMA or LPN Spanish/English (Registered Medical Assistant or Licensed Practical Nurse)

Work from home Full-time role

Creative Marketing Strategist

Work from home Full-time role

Experienced Travel Data Entry Specialist – Entry Level Position for Detail-Oriented and Organized Individuals with a Passion for Travel Management and Data Integrity

Work from home Full-time role

Experienced Full-Time Online Data Entry Assistant and Virtual Personal Associate - Remote Work Opportunity with Flexible Hours and Competitive Pay

Work from home Full-time role

Experienced Sales and Customer Support Representative for Dynamic Airbnb Cleaning Operation at Blithequark

Work from home Full-time role

Job Title: Experienced Customer Service Representative – Remote Opportunity with arenaflex's Southwest Airlines Partnership

Work from home Full-time role

Medical Insurance AR Follow-Up Specialist

Work from home Full-time role